New spam control added to Mxtreme Mail Firewall

Tuesday, 12 November 2002, 4:43 PM EST

BorderWare Technologies Inc. announced today a new weapon in the war against SPAM and unwanted email. This is the latest innovation to the MXtreme Mail Firewall range of appliances.

MXtreme's new SPAM control gets smarter as you use it. The system uses adaptive local learning techniques. MXtreme combines traditional SPAM controls with a new technology based on an advanced lexical analysis algorithm.

MXtreme is flexible and self-learning. It automatically adjusts SPAM detection rules according to local language. Each company can set their own controls for SPAM tolerance without interfering with legitimate email traffic.
